Output 683294d302d153b308572ba7cf6106962f86817c007c762660a8172e6d059782:2

value
44696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6cbff4434259df1db78cf390e357497612bb6d OP_EQUAL
address
3MhEBdBYCbPjHYGbvsRt1Y6pZJyYVe95Lg
transaction
683294d302d153b308572ba7cf6106962f86817c007c762660a8172e6d059782